Main aims of WP10

  • Deliver the necessary atmospheric surface fields to the WP8 and WP9 ocean modelling community.
  • Study the atmospheric response to sea state conditions and especially to SST spatio-temporal variability in the Mediterranean Sea
  • Explore the role of the sea surface fluxes in the formation and evolution of characteristic weather regimes.
  • Examine the potential benefits of highly resolved non-hydrostatic atmospheric flows in regional/shelf ocean modelling.
  • Define the experimental strategy for the Scientific Validation Period (SVP) inter-comparison exercise.
  • Validate the various model results produced during the SVP-WP10 and other related hindcasting operations against observations from various sources.
